About The Embassy
The Embassy is a Canadian, Oscar-nominated production house, specializing in live-action production, post-production, and animation for feature films, television, and commercials. We are an independent creative studio with expertise in visual effects and production. Located in the heart of Vancouver’s Digital District, we work with global production companies, agencies and brands in film, television and advertising.
Award-Winning
We have crafted award-winning visual effects for the world’s most recognized brands and film franchises. Our work has received accolades including Oscar nominations and numerous VES, Cannes, D&AD;, Clio & ADCC awards.

Your Role
Finalizes the overall look, colour balance, and quality for shots and sequences
Creates uniformity and seamless transitions between footage and composited elements
Establish certain looks and/or solve particular design or effects challenges for key visual effects shots;
Full shot compositing including keying,
paint & roto when required
Collaborate with other compositors & supervisors to share knowledge and techniques
Meet project milestones and deadlines on time
Make corrections and adjustments requested by the supervisor
Your Qualifications
3+ years of Compositing experience in commercials, film, or TV
Excellent with Nuke, and knowledge of other compositing, finishing, and editorial tools is an asset
Solid understanding of all elements and visual aspects of a shot
Strong understanding of multiple aspects of the VFX pipeline
Ability to take direction positively and work well within a team
Possess a keen eye for colour and colour matching
Excellent communication and organizational skills with the ability to multitask in a deadline-driven environment
Lookdev experience is a bonus
